dcterms:description
The publication introduces the reader to the basic principles and models available for structural fire design. The lessons are focused to specific questions, which are crucial for prediciton of structural behaviour of building exposed to fire: heat development in fire compartment, structural elements behaviour, integrated structural behaviour and integrity of structure mostly depends to connections robustness. The design procedures are demonstrated on worked examples prepared according to structural fire Eurocodes EN 199x-1-2.
